Introduction to Rhamnolipids and Its Market Analysis
Rhamnolipids are a type of biosurfactant produced by various bacteria, including Pseudomonas aeruginosa. They are composed of two molecules - rhamnose and lipid - and are used in various industries such as agriculture, cosmetics, and pharmaceuticals due to their ability to reduce surface tension and emulsify hydrophobic compounds. The advantages of Rhamnolipids include biodegradability, low toxicity, and high efficiency in various applications. In terms of Product Application, the Rhamnolipids market is segmented into:
Rhamnolipids, a type of biosurfactant, are used in various industries including oil recovery, agriculture, food processing, cosmetics, medicines, and other sectors. In oil recovery, rhamnolipids are used to enhance oil recovery efficiency. In agriculture, they can be used as biopesticides and in soil remediation. In the food industry, they are used as emulsifiers and stabilizers. In cosmetics, they are used for their moisturizing and skin-friendly properties. In medicine, they have antimicrobial properties and can be used in drug delivery systems. The fastest-growing application segment in terms of revenue is expected to be in the oil recovery industry.
